Z43.0 is the authoritative medical code for Encounter for attention to tracheostomy. This classification is used in medical billing and clinical recording to specify the clinical criteria for encounter for attention to tracheostomy (ICD-10-CM Z43.0), ensuring healthcare documentation aligns with 2026 federal coding standards.
Billing Status: YES. This is a valid, specific, and billable ICD-10-CM reference.
Official Registry Overview & Definition
Encounter for attention to tracheostomy is a billable ICD-10-CM diagnosis code Z43.0. Includes: closure of artificial openings; passage of sounds or bougies through artificial openings; reforming artificial openings; removal of catheter from artificial openings; toilet or cleansing of artificial openings. Excludes1 (not coded here): complications of external stoma (J95.0-, K94.-, N99.5-). Excludes2 (not included here): fitting and adjustment of prosthetic and other devices Z44-Z46; follow-up examination for medical surveillance after treatment Z08-Z09.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) & Clinical Guidance
What can't be coded together with Z43.0?
Per official ICD-10-CM Excludes1 instructions, Z43.0 must not be reported together with: complications of external stoma (J95.0-, K94.-, N99.5-).
Can Z43.0 be reported alongside related conditions?
Per official ICD-10-CM Excludes2 instructions, Z43.0 and the following are not considered part of each other and may both be reported when both conditions are present: fitting and adjustment of prosthetic and other devices (Z44-Z46); follow-up examination for medical surveillance after treatment (Z08-Z09).
Nearest Codes in This Family
Official ICD-10-CM classifications closest to Z43.0 in its code family, with their registry titles.
- Z43 — Encounter for attention to artificial openings
- Z43.1 — Encounter for attention to gastrostomy
- Z43.2 — Encounter for attention to ileostomy
- Z43.3 — Encounter for attention to colostomy
- Z43.4 — Encounter for attention to other artificial openings of digestive tract
- Z43.5 — Encounter for attention to cystostomy
- Z43.6 — Encounter for attention to other artificial openings of urinary tract
- Z43.7 — Encounter for attention to artificial vagina
- Z43.8 — Encounter for attention to other artificial openings
- Z43.9 — Encounter for attention to unspecified artificial opening
